anticline
C2Noun/US /ˈæntɪklˌaɪn/ ĂNT-ĭkl-īn; UK /ˈæntɪklˌaɪn/ ĂNT-ĭkl-īn/
A structure of bedded rocks in which the beds on both sides of an axis or axial plane dip away from the axis; an anticlinal.
